Transaction

c324da85ef0bc0c5748cae44f160f2bae0d4d03afaad4e515ae1f9fc60d37b96
623,231 confirmations
Timestamp
1405827784
Block311,613
Fee50,000 sats
Fee rate11.8 sats/vB
view on mempool.space

Inputs & Outputs